Output 59051a1c4ac3f91bb9bcc656a5d6b50186cd897b385ef534913ab4f39105c2ec:17

value
128374
script pubkey
OP_0 OP_PUSHBYTES_20 3dfe5784d28ee56c3e580d5b5afb2c5de019091d
address
bc1q8hl90pxj3mjkc0jcp4d447evthspjzga05m28a
transaction
59051a1c4ac3f91bb9bcc656a5d6b50186cd897b385ef534913ab4f39105c2ec